When Gaming Technology Solves Business Problems

Unity powers 50% of mobile games and countless AAA titles, but increasingly it's building business applications—product configurators, training simulations, data visualizations, and AR/VR experiences. Understanding Unity's business advantages helps companies make informed platform decisions.

Unity's Key Business Advantages

Cross-platform deployment: Build once, deploy to 25+ platforms—iOS, Android, WebGL, Windows, Mac, VR headsets, AR devices. This dramatically reduces development costs versus platform-specific coding.

Extensive asset store: Pre-built 3D models, scripts, tools, and templates accelerate development. Need realistic office furniture? Buy entire packs for £50-200 rather than modeling from scratch.

Robust physics engine: Realistic object behavior for training simulations. Items fall, collide, and interact naturally without custom physics programming.

Visual development: Non-programmers can build scenes, arrange objects, and create experiences using intuitive interfaces. This lowers skill barriers for rapid prototyping.

Large developer community: Thousands of Unity developers available for hire. Solutions to problems exist in forums, reducing development time and troubleshooting costs.

Business Application Examples

Product configurators: Customers customize products in real-time 3D—changing colors, materials, options. Automotive, furniture, and industrial equipment industries use configurators reducing sales cycles and order errors.

Training simulations: VR safety training, equipment operation, emergency procedures. Unity's physics and interactivity create realistic practice environments impossible in classrooms.

Data visualization: Complex datasets become 3D visualizations. Financial data, scientific research, or business intelligence transforms from spreadsheets into interactive explorable spaces.

AR product demonstrations: Sales teams use tablets showing products in customer spaces. Equipment manufacturers demonstrate machinery installation before physical delivery.

Virtual showrooms: Product catalogs become 3D spaces customers explore. Real estate, automotive, and retail create immersive browsing experiences.

Licensing Costs Breakdown

Unity Personal (Free):

  • For companies under $100K revenue/funding
  • Full engine access
  • Deploy to all platforms
  • Unity splash screen required

Unity Plus ($40/month per seat):

  • For companies under $200K revenue/funding
  • Removes Unity splash screen
  • Additional services and support

Unity Pro ($150/month per seat):

  • No revenue restrictions
  • Advanced features and priority support
  • Team collaboration tools

Unity Enterprise (Custom pricing):

  • For large organizations
  • Custom terms and support
  • Dedicated success management

Developer Availability and Costs

Unity developer market is mature and competitive:

  • Junior developers: £25-40/hour or £35K-50K annually
  • Mid-level developers: £40-70/hour or £50K-70K annually
  • Senior developers: £70-120/hour or £70K-100K+ annually
  • Agencies: £60-150/hour depending on expertise

Large talent pool means competitive pricing and availability versus specialized engines with limited developer bases.

Learning Curve Considerations

Unity accessibility varies by role:

  • Non-technical users: 1-2 weeks basic scene creation
  • Programmers new to Unity: 2-3 weeks to productivity
  • Complete beginners: 2-3 months to useful contributions
  • Advanced features: 6-12 months to master complex systems

Extensive documentation, tutorials, and courses accelerate learning. Businesses can train internal staff or hire experienced developers.

Unity vs. Unreal Engine

Choose Unity when:

  • Mobile/WebGL deployment important
  • 2D elements or simpler 3D graphics
  • Rapid prototyping priority
  • C# programming language preferred
  • Developer availability matters

Choose Unreal when:

  • Maximum graphical fidelity required
  • PC/console-only deployment
  • Photorealistic rendering essential
  • C++ programming acceptable
  • Architecture/visualization focus

Unity vs. WebGL Frameworks

Choose Unity when:

  • Cross-platform deployment needed
  • Complex physics or interactions
  • VR/AR features required
  • Asset store resources valuable

Choose WebGL (Three.js, Babylon.js) when:

  • Web-only deployment
  • Simpler 3D visualizations
  • File size critical (Unity bundles larger)
  • Custom web integration essential
